Piezoelectric Flexible Sensor for Capturing Changes in Structures for Architecture

Thin, flexible, and highly sensitive! It captures subtle changes in structures, enhancing safety.

To enhance the safety of buildings, it is important to detect subtle changes in structures at an early stage. However, conventional sensors have limitations regarding installation locations and the shapes of structures, making installation difficult in some cases. Fujibo's "Piezoelectric Flexible Sensor" is thin and flexible, allowing it to be installed in wet locations. Additionally, it is highly sensitive and can capture minute changes, thereby further improving the safety of structures. 【Usage Scenarios】 - Monitoring the deterioration of structures such as bridges and tunnels (vibration sensors) - Assessing damage from natural disasters like earthquakes and typhoons (impact sensors) 【Benefits of Implementation】 - By detecting abnormalities in structures early, appropriate measures can be taken, enhancing safety. - It can be installed in locations where conventional sensors were difficult to place, enabling broader monitoring. - It is thin and flexible, can be installed in wet locations, and will not rust.

【Features】 - It is a sensor with a thickness of less than 50μm, laminated with organic materials on the substrate surface, making it thin and flexible. - It is also possible to manufacture piezoelectric element arrays. - It can be installed in wet locations. - It supports specifications with high signal-to-noise ratios due to an electromagnetic wave shielding layer (optional). - It can be utilized for vital sensing, vibration, impact, and water leak detection. - It is compatible with haptic devices utilizing the reverse piezoelectric effect (under development).
